Java 9 - What’s hot, whats not

Introduction

This repository & RevealJS HTML slide presentation tries to give an overview over the improvments coming with Java 9.

It’s based on the current state as of 2016-07-01.

Contents

presentation

A short RevealJS based presentation. Just open index.html

playground

Extensive collection of various one-class code examples illustrating the changes. Start here for your experiments!

playground-dependent

Another Jigsaw module depending on playground and demonstrating Service Provider with modules.

run-with-modules

Bash script demonstrating how to compile & run the example as modules using the new Java9 command line parameters

Getting started

  1. Install Java 9 EAP

  2. Ensure JAVA_HOME and PATH points to Java 9

  3. Open project with IntelliJ IDEA 2016.2+ or run run-with-modules

$ env | grep JAVA_HOME
JAVA_HOME=/usr/lib/jvm/java-9-oracle
$ javac -version
javac 9-ea
$ java -version
java version "9-ea"
Java(TM) SE Runtime Environment (build 9-ea+123)
Java HotSpot(TM) 64-Bit Server VM (build 9-ea+123, mixed mode)
